Hi, Josh,

I think that you will have to work hard to catch up!
You will need a good range of GCSEs - say 8 subjects, at good grades, and A levels at A or A* in Chemistry, Biology and Physics or Maths to have a reasonable chance of being offered a place at a UK vet school.
